Study finds talking therapy 'can stop suicide'

Talking therapy can prevent people bent on suicide from stepping over the brink, a study has found.

Six to 10 counselling sessions reduced suicide deaths by more than a quarter in a group of Danish men and women who had already tried to kill themselves.
